DBT requires the therapist to be authentic and, at times, confrontational. While this may be difficult to hear, I believe it's important for personal growth to acknowledge where we're getting stuck. I will make sure we have a rapport built first and will always welcome feedback on the process. I want this to be a safe and non-judgmental environment for you to embark on your therapeutic journey. My specialty is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T). This involves the practice of learning to walk the middle ground between black and white thinking. This allows you to see that two ideas can be true at the same time. I personally work with these skills on a daily basis, so I practice what I preach. My hope when working with you is to open you up to the possibility of accepting and creating your own happiness.
